Sump Pump Failure Water Removal Cost in Avondale, AZ
The cost of Sump Pump Failure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Avondale, AZ. You can expect our team to provide a detailed estimate for the work, including any necessary repairs or replacements.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the complexity of the job affect the cost.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ment used affect the cost. |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ials used for repairs affect the cost. |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job affect the cost. |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ation) | $1,000 – $5,000 | The type and extent of the more services affect the cost. |

Common Questions About Sump Pump Failure Water Removal
Q: What causes sump pump failure?
A: Sump pump failure can be caused by a variety of factors, including power outages, clogged filters, and worn-out parts. Our team can assess the situation and provide a customized solution to prevent future failures.

Q: Can I prevent Sump Pump Failure Water Removal?
A: Yes, you can take proactive steps to prevent Sump Pump Failure Water Removal.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ning the sump pit and checking the float switch, can help extend the life of your sump pump. Our team can provide personalized advice and solutions to help you prevent future failures.
